What is a VA Loan?

The VA loan program is a mortgage option created specifically for veterans, active-duty service members, and eligible surviving spouses. It is provided by private lenders but partially guaranteed by the Department of Veterans Affairs.

This government backing gives lenders more confidence, allowing them to offer favorable terms like zero down payment and competitive interest rates that are often lower than conventional mortgages.

VA Loan Advantages

Discover why the VA loan is considered the premier mortgage program for those who qualify.

Zero Down Payment

Purchase your Arizona home with $0 down payment. Unlike most loan programs, you don't need years of savings to get started.

No Monthly PMI

Conventional loans require private mortgage insurance if you put less than 20% down. VA loans never require monthly PMI, saving you hundreds.

Lower Interest Rates

Because the government guarantees a portion of the loan, interest rates are typically 0.25% to 0.50% lower than conventional rates.

Flexible Credit Score

VA loans are more forgiving with credit history. Even if your score isn't perfect, you may still qualify for excellent terms.

Reusable Benefit

Your VA entitlement is a lifelong benefit. You can use it to buy your first home, and use it again later for your next home.

No Prepayment Penalty

You have the freedom to pay off your loan early or refinance at any time without facing financial penalties.

VA Loan Eligibility

Active Duty Service

Service members currently on active duty are eligible after 90 continuous days of service.

Veterans

Eligibility depends on the length and period of service, typically 90 days during wartime or 181 days during peacetime.

National Guard & Reserves

Members of the National Guard and Reserves are typically eligible after six years of service or 90 days of active service.

Surviving Spouses

Un-remarried surviving spouses of veterans who died in the line of duty or from a service-connected disability may be eligible.

Certificate of Eligibility (COE)

To prove eligibility, you need a COE. We can obtain this for you electronically from the VA in just a few minutes.
